HighLights
- 140+/- acre hunting tract in the Ouachita Mountains in Latimer County, Southeast Oklahoma
- Mixed pine timber and mature hardwoods provides varied habitat for whitetail deer
- Long ridge‑top terrain with both south‑facing and north‑facing slopes for seasonal wildlife movement
- North Peachland Creek at the base of the property serves as a consistent water source
- Access via a lease road on the section line
- Showings by appointment only; approximate boundary lines shown—buyers advised to verify with an independent survey
Overview
The land is characterized by a secluded, back-woods feel, with the ridge and slope changes forming natural travel, feeding, and bedding patterns described in the remarks. The creek at the lower portion of the tract supports the overall habitat mix. Showings are by appointment only, and the boundary lines shown are approximate for general reference.
For buyers seeking a private outdoor parcel, the combination of timber cover, ridge-top topography, and creek access supports a turn-key approach for recreational hunting planning. The seller notes the tract can accommodate uses such as an off-grid hunting camp, subject to buyer due diligence. As with any land purchase, buyers are encouraged to obtain an independent survey to confirm exact boundaries.
